Jermu Pollanen (Hyvinkaa, FIN) finished 5-2 in the 16-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Pollanen defeated Spain's Sergio Vez 8-1, then won 6-5 against Lukas Klima (Prague, CZE) and 8-5 against Reto Seiler (Sofia, BUL). Pollanen won 9-5 against Otto Kalocsay (Budapest, HUN). Pollanen went on to lose 8-6 against James Pougher (Deeside, WAL). Pollanen responded with a 9-2 win over Pavol Pitonak (Bratislava, SVK). Pollanen went on to lose 12-9 against Harri Lill (Tallinn, EST) in their final qualifying round match.
With their runner-up finish at the Le Gruyere AOP European B Curling Championships, Pollanen take home 19.594 world rankings points, moving up 34 spots the World Ranking Standings into 96th place overall with 49.781 total points. Pollanen ranks 69th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 43.718 points earned so far this season.
